{allcanada} Senators' Chabot, Sanford, Tierney enter

 

Thomas Chabot, Zach Sanford and Chris Tierney were placed in NHL COVID-19 protocol by the Senators on Monday.

Chabot, a defenseman, has scored 17 points (one goal, 16 assists) in 29 games, and leads the NHL with an average ice time of 27:13 per game.

"It's a huge loss for us, but teams lose guys all the time," Senators coach D.J. Smith said. "That's how you find out what you have."

Tierney and Sanford, each a forward, join forwards Josh Norris, Tyler Ennis and Nick Paul, and defensemen Jacob Bernard-Docker and Dillon Heatherington in protocol.

Defenseman Michael Del Zotto was recalled from Belleville of the American Hockey League and forward Scott Sabourin was added to the taxi squad.

"We are confident in our group, but we are missing a lot of key guys," Ottawa captain Brady Tkachuk told TSN 1200. "So all we can do is be ready to go and it's a next man up mentality."

The Senators will practice Wednesday. Their game against the Seattle Kraken on Thursday was postponed because of COVID-19 related issues. Ottawa is scheduled to visit the Vancouver Canucks on Saturday.
